网站优化

网站优化

Products

当前位置:首页 > 网站优化 >

阅读本文,轻松掌握多线程实例,提升编程技能!

GG网络技术分享 2025-11-22 09:35 0


哇塞,巨大家优良呀!今天我们要来聊聊一个非常酷的手艺——许多线程!你晓得吗,许多线程就像是电脑里的超级英雄,Neng一边Zuohen许多事情呢!接下来我们就一起kankan怎么用许多线程来提升我们的编程技Neng吧!

啥是许多线程呢?

哎呀,许多线程就是让电脑一边Zuohen许多事情的一种方法。就像你一边吃饭一边kan电视一样,电脑也Neng一边处理一个任务,一边处理另一个任务,是不是hen神奇呀?

许多线程的计时器,怎么在JSP里获取啊?

哦哦,这玩意儿我晓得!先说说我们要用bean标签导入计时器。当用户访问一个JSP页面时会向一个Servlet容器发出求。这时会在web容器里建立实例。然后我们就Neng在JSP里用这玩意儿计时器啦!

JSP的施行过程

当客户端第一次求某一个JSP文件时 服务端会把该文件编译成一个CLASS文件,并创建一个该类的实例,然后创建一个线程处理CLIENT端的求。Ru果有优良几个客户端一边求该JSP文件,则服务端会创建优良几个线程。个个客户端求对应一个线程。这样,我们就Neng用许多线程来搞优良系统的并发量及响应时候啦!

JSP的中存在的许多线程问题

哎呀, 虽然许多线程hen有力巨大,但是也会有一些问题哦。比如Ru果优良几个线程一边操作同一个材料,就要注意同步问题啦。不然就会出现一些困难以找到的错误哦。

实例变量和局部变量

实例变量是在堆中分配的, 并被属于该实例的全部线程共享,所以不是线程平安的。而局部变量在堆栈中分配,基本上原因是个个线程dou有它自己的堆栈地方,所以是线程平安的。这就是说我们要细小心用实例变量哦,不然就会出问题啦!

许多线程的编程管束

哦哦,许多线程也有一些管束呢。基本上原因是该servlet始终驻于内存,所以响应是非常迅速的。但Ru果.jsp文件被修改了 服务器将根据设置决定是不是对该文件沉新鲜编译,Ru果需要沉新鲜编译,则将编译后来啊取代内存中的servlet,并接着来上述处理过程。虽然JSP效率hen高大,但在第一次调用时由于需要转换和编译而有一些轻巧微的延迟。

哇塞, 通过学许多线程,我们不仅Neng搞优良编程技Neng,还Neng让电脑变得geng加有力巨大呢!迅速来试试kan吧,相信你一定会喜欢上许多线程的!

标签:

提交需求或反馈

Demand feedback